Morning crackers with ham and figs

2 servings

20 minutes

Morning crackers with ham and figs are a refined European breakfast that combines delicate, sweet, and salty flavors. Crispy crackers serve as a base for airy cream cheese, which can be replaced with goat cheese or ricotta. Thinly sliced ham (prosciutto, bresaola) adds piquancy and sophistication. Baked figs reveal their sweetness, while floral honey enhances the aroma, giving the dish a refined depth of flavor. This recipe is an example of the harmony of simple ingredients transformed into gastronomic pleasure.

Ingredients
2servings
Crackers
4 
pc
Hamon
2 
pc
Cottage cheese
50 
g
Fig
2 
pc
Flower honey
2 
tbsp
Cooking steps
  • 1

    Preheat the oven to 180 degrees.

  • 2

    Cut the figs into quarters and place them in the oven for 7 minutes to soften.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Fig2 pieces
  • 3

    Spread a thin layer of cream cheese on each cracker (can be replaced with goat cheese or ricotta), then place a slice of ham (prosciutto, bresaola, or any other meat, sliced very thin with minimal fat content) on top.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Crackers4 pieces
    2. Cottage cheese50 g
    3. Hamon2 pieces
  • 4

    On top, place a quarter of a fig and drizzle with floral honey (any honey will do, such as lavender, linden, or truffle honey).

    Required ingredients:
    1. Fig2 pieces
    2. Flower honey2 tablespoons
